Bankrupt NHL Goalie on the Hook for Snake Debt, Court Told (1)

May 5, 2023, 7:28 PM UTCUpdated: May 5, 2023, 9:33 PM UTC

Bankrupt NHL goalie Robin Lehner is liable for hundreds of thousands of dollars he owes for a large inventory of exotic snakes, the snake seller told a court.

Lehner breached his contract by not paying for the snakes he ordered and caused at least $350,000 in annual lost profits, Boca Raton, Fla.-based JHB Collective LLC told the US Bankruptcy Court for the District of Nevada on Thursday.
